Which statement describes the lines whose equations are y=1/3x+12 and 6y=2x+6
ICE Princess25 [194]
First, you should solve both equations for the same variable. Since the first one is already solved for y, solve the second equation for y as well.

6y = 2x + 6   Divide both sides by 6
y = \frac{1}{3}x + 1

You can see that both lines have a slope of \frac{1}{3}.
Lines that have the same slope are parallel lines.
